Default 1998 ram 5.9 gas, missing bad. no power

Hi there this is my first time posting question. I have a 1998 dodge 4x4 360 gas. Just had the pump replace in the trans. The macnic said he drove around the block and shifted and ran fine then he parked and called me to come pick it up. I get there try to start it and itstarts but is missing alout and will notidil up justmisses no power what so ever. we mess with it all day,check to see if there is a air problem. Change plugs still the same thing we go back to autoparts store and get a cap and button and rent a scan computer. We scan it and code says (ignition/dist speed malfuction) and code2 (miss fire) we install the cap and button. (what dose ignition/ dist speed malfuction mean)still same. I try to reave it up for about 2-3 min in frustration andpart of theexhauststart to glow red . thats when we stop working on it please help me where do I go from here.

is the part of the exhaust that glows before or after the catalytic converter? if it is before then i would bet that the cat is clogged up. that will also cause a missfire. on my 99 360 i had a #8 missfire when mine clogged

If not the cat, the cam sensor wire might have sagged down and become pinched between the block and the bell housing during reassembly. If it is shorting out your fuel sync could be off enough to make you run real lean. Lean will make the exhaust around the motor so hot it will give you a tan. Just a guess.
